Default Double clicking to remove a maintained enchantment

would it break the game if i was able to press one button in order to remove an enchantment? having to hover over and double click the skill is depressing. it discourages me to use enchants such as aura of displacement.

i suggest being able to just hit the skill again and it revert to cooldown

for example: i cast aura of displacement, hit it again and cooldown begins.

ps: CLICKING SUCKS.

This is actually something I noticed to be odd when I first started the game (took me awhile to figure out how to drop retribution on my R/mo). So I guess I would say I'm for a change except people have gotten so used to this double clicking method I don't think changing it this late in the game's life would do more good than be an annoyance. If maintainable effects make an appearance in GW2 then I do hope they give us a smoother method of dropping them.

For the time being, if double clicking is difficult for you then go to mouse options and adjust the double click speed. Resizing the maintained 'chants on UI might also help.
